Christopher Marks Posted April 25, 2019 Author Share Posted April 25, 2019 32 minutes ago, ksadam said: Just for clarification, on April 30th whatever is on the tank and running is to be used for the whole competition? Or are changes and upgrades allowed throughout the contest period as long as they stay within the specified rules? Changes to equipment can be made during the contest as long as they stay within the specified requirements. A qualifying HOB filter could be added later during the competition, or removed later, for example. A heater or powerhead could fail along the way and need replacement. Some competitors may want to change their plans for filtration and circulation along the way, this is ok too. Tank replacements may also be needed as accidents happen, replacement tanks should be similar to the previous tank. I'm sure many people will journal the changes they make, and our base journal photo requirement will also document changes made over time.
